Commit Graph

925 Commits

Author SHA1 Message Date
lsp 7683b144e0 code review 2022-01-07 14:53:08 +08:00
yj 049f28aca5 merge with jdk8u212-ga and add sw port 2021-12-27 09:35:40 +08:00
Andrew John Hughes a2b19c632a 8189761: COMPANY_NAME, IMPLEMENTOR, BUNDLE_VENDOR, VENDOR, but no configure flag
Reviewed-by: erikj, dholmes
2019-03-29 15:03:32 +00:00
Andrew John Hughes 96b3a3e80d 8217753: Enable HotSpot builds on 5.x Linux kernels
Remove Linux kernel version check as very unlikely a kernel older than 2.4 will be used.

Reviewed-by: erikj
2019-03-15 17:22:25 +00:00
Severin Gehwolf 2e413d5aaf 8212110: Build of saproc.dll broken on Windows 32 bit after JDK-8210647
Reviewed-by: erikj, akasko
2018-11-09 12:39:09 +01:00
Severin Gehwolf 734ee3856a 8210647: libsaproc is being compiled without optimization
Reviewed-by: erikj, jcbeyler
2018-11-09 10:38:30 +01:00
David Buck 7aca5323b6 8141491: Unaligned memory access in Bits.c
Introduce alignment-safe Copy::conjoint_swap and JVM_CopySwapMemory

Reviewed-by: mikael, dholmes
2018-12-03 07:29:54 -05:00
Kevin Walls 9f9a0db495 8211933: [8u] hotspot adlc needs to link statically with libstdc++ for gcc7.3
Reviewed-by: erikj
2018-10-25 04:34:20 -07:00
Severin Gehwolf daacd4089c 8073139: PPC64: User-visible arch directory and os.arch value on ppc64le cause issues with Java tooling
Reviewed-by: erikj, goetz, dholmes
2018-09-25 16:23:35 +02:00
Severin Gehwolf eb3317696e 8210350: -Wl,-z,defs JDK 8 build failure
Reviewed-by: erikj
2018-09-20 16:05:22 +02:00
Severin Gehwolf 093e6425e5 8207057: No debug info for assembler files
Generate debug info for assembler files as needed.

Reviewed-by: erikj
2018-09-19 14:26:01 -04:00
David Buck 46ba47bb3a 8033251: Use DWARF debug symbols for Linux 32-bit as default
Reviewed-by: tbell
2018-08-16 23:50:43 -04:00
Kevin Walls 967e51e77d 8209359: [8u] hotspot needs to recognise cl.exe 19.13 to build with VS2017
Reviewed-by: tbell
2018-08-10 08:29:53 -07:00
Severin Gehwolf 9bc9e5c82f 8207402: Stray *.debuginfo files when not stripping debug info
Only produce those files if STRIP_POLICY != no_strip

Reviewed-by: erikj
2018-07-17 17:07:44 +02:00
Severin Gehwolf c599c02a66 8206425: .gnu_debuglink sections added unconditionally when no debuginfo is stripped
Only add .gnu_debuglink sections when there is some stripping done.

Reviewed-by: erikj, dholmes
2018-07-05 18:27:02 +02:00
Severin Gehwolf 3cf79c7534 8205104: EXTRA_LDFLAGS not consistently being used
Add EXTRA_LDFLAGS to linker flags for relevant libraries.

Reviewed-by: ihse
2018-06-15 14:30:02 +02:00
David Buck 2f4ec6bdbb 8204053: libsaproc.so not linked with -z,noexecstack
Reviewed-by: erikj, dholmes
2018-06-05 10:33:56 -04:00
Kevin Walls c652c01fd9 8203349: 8u hotspot should recognise later Windows compilers
Reviewed-by: erikj
2018-05-21 03:13:55 -07:00
Erik Joelsson fb4cc8ee5b 8134157: adlc fails to compile with SS12u4
Reviewed-by: dholmes, kbarrett, ihse
2015-08-28 09:57:54 +02:00
Erik Joelsson afa5489b65 8138692: libjsig compilation is missing EXTRA_CFLAGS on macosx
Reviewed-by: ihse, mikael
2015-10-02 10:15:46 +02:00
David Buck fe1815815f 8187045: [linux] Not all libraries in the VM are linked with -z,noexecstack
Reviewed-by: dholmes, erikj
2018-01-16 04:20:19 -05:00
Poonam Bajaj bee8f867ed 8153252: SA: Hotspot build on Windows fails if make/closed folder does not exist
Reviewed-by: dsamersoff, erikj
2016-04-14 11:08:30 -07:00
Abhijit Saha 2b4efaebb7 Merge 2016-01-15 16:21:59 -08:00
Abhijit Saha c074a82bc3 Merge 2016-01-05 08:28:01 -08:00
Abhijit Saha 02559e91da Merge 2015-10-14 12:16:18 -07:00
Abhijit Saha 4c4ec5e968 Merge 2015-10-06 11:58:13 -07:00
Erik Joelsson 9444ea37cc 8136980: build for 8u65 and 8u66 for solaris platforms is failing
Reviewed-by: ihse, mikael, brutisso
2015-10-06 12:18:17 +02:00
Abhijit Saha 4bd2e6fc8c Merge 2015-09-21 23:31:09 -07:00
Abhijit Saha 5fc12881b6 Merge 2015-09-21 21:30:51 -07:00
Erik Joelsson 3992a9d685 8136691: 8u65/8u66 b14 Solaris builds failed on Linking libverify.so
Reviewed-by: tbell, mikael
2015-09-21 21:41:11 +02:00
Abhijit Saha ced5a1c42f Merge 2015-07-28 23:38:46 -07:00
Gerald Thornbrugh b0c5ee05b9 8048232: Fix for 8046471 breaks PPC64 build
Reviewed-by: dcubed, mikael
2015-12-18 10:11:58 -08:00
Gerald Thornbrugh f031546810 8046471: Use OPENJDK_TARGET_CPU_ARCH instead of legacy value for hotspot ARCH
Reviewed-by: dcubed, mikael
2015-12-17 17:17:31 -08:00
Alejandro Murillo 5d282f2e23 8079410: Hotspot version to share the same update and build version from JDK
Reviewed-by: dholmes, dcubed
2015-07-21 15:35:12 -07:00
Alejandro Murillo 6dc151b798 8131628: new hotspot build - hs25.66-b03
Reviewed-by: dholmes
2015-07-17 01:04:08 -07:00
Alejandro Murillo 01e7710183 8131588: new hotspot build - hs25.66-b02
Reviewed-by: dholmes
2015-07-15 14:50:58 -07:00
Abhijit Saha 3b93cc1912 8131182: Increment minor version of HSx for 8u71 and initialize the build number
Reviewed-by: katleman
2015-07-14 11:31:34 -07:00
Abhijit Saha ca88f10b48 Merge 2015-06-17 23:23:12 -07:00
Abhijit Saha 24a3589fc7 Merge 2015-06-11 09:17:21 -07:00
Abhijit Saha 9081d7c79a Merge 2015-06-04 15:15:08 -07:00
Abhijit Saha 9767a3bc82 8076505: Increment minor version of HSx for 8u65 and initialize the build number
Reviewed-by: katleman
2015-04-01 12:55:07 -07:00
Abhijit Saha fe2619159d Merge 2015-02-12 08:24:18 -08:00
Abhijit Saha dc9050045f Merge 2015-02-04 13:10:46 -08:00
Volker Simonis 141cb78f45 8146979: Backport of 8046471 breaks ppc64 build in jdk8u because 8072383 was badly backported before
Reviewed-by: erikj, dholmes
2016-01-13 20:47:17 -05:00
Matthias Baesken 9fa2ad99c5 8069590: AIX port of "8050807: Better performing performance data handling"
Co-authored-by: Martin Doerr <martin.doerr@sap.com>
Reviewed-by: simonis, goetz
2015-01-13 16:09:52 +01:00
Alejandro Murillo 4fcf445113 Merge 2015-01-20 13:47:31 -08:00
Abhijit Saha d8090eceaa Merge 2015-01-15 11:19:46 -08:00
Alejandro Murillo b4096990c2 8069209: new hotspot build - hs25.40-b25
Reviewed-by: jcoomes
2015-01-16 11:00:29 -08:00
Abhijit Saha fd9c62c236 8068674: Increment minor version of HSx for 8u51 and initialize the build number
Reviewed-by: jcoomes
2015-01-08 08:46:36 -08:00
Abhijit Saha 41706a4223 Merge 2014-12-17 12:48:26 -08:00